Introduction to Convection Microwave Ovens

Before we dive into the culinary delights that can be prepared using a convection microwave oven, it’s essential to understand how this appliance works. Combining the principles of microwave cooking with convection heating, these ovens provide a rapid and efficient method of cooking that retains the nutrients and flavors of the ingredients. Unlike traditional microwaves that rely solely on microwave energy, convection microwave ovens use a fan to circulate hot air, allowing for even cooking and browning, similar to a conventional oven.

Understanding Convection Cooking

Convection cooking is a method where hot air is circulated around the food to cook it evenly. This technique reduces cooking time and helps in achieving a crispy exterior and a tender interior, characteristics that are often lacking in traditional microwave cooking. The incorporation of convection technology into microwave ovens has opened up new avenues for cooking a variety of dishes, from simple snacks to complex meals.

How does a convection microwave oven differ from a traditional microwave oven?

A convection microwave oven differs significantly from a traditional microwave oven in terms of its functionality and cooking capabilities. Unlike traditional microwave ovens that rely solely on microwave energy to cook food, convection microwave ovens combine microwave energy with a convection heating element and a fan to circulate hot air. This allows for even cooking, browning, and crisping of food, which is not possible with traditional microwave ovens. The convection feature also enables cooking methods such as roasting, baking, and grilling, making it a more versatile appliance.

The cooking results from a convection microwave oven are also more comparable to those from a traditional oven, but with the added benefit of faster cooking times. In contrast, traditional microwave ovens are typically limited to reheating, defrosting, and basic cooking tasks, and may not produce the same level of browning or crisping. Additionally, convection microwave ovens often come with more advanced features such as sensor cooking, multi-stage cooking, and preset menus, making them easier to use and more convenient than traditional microwave ovens. This makes convection microwave ovens a great option for those looking to upgrade their cooking experience.

Can I use metal utensils and cookware in a convection microwave oven?

It’s generally not recommended to use metal utensils and cookware in a convection microwave oven, as they can cause arcing or sparks, which can lead to a fire or damage the oven. However, some convection microwave ovens are designed to be metal-safe, and the user manual may specify which types of metal cookware are allowed. It’s essential to read and follow the manufacturer’s guidelines to ensure safe and proper use of the oven. In general, it’s best to use microwave-safe cookware, such as glass, ceramic, or plastic, to avoid any potential risks.

If metal cookware is allowed, it’s crucial to use it correctly to avoid any accidents. For example, some convection microwave ovens may require the use of a metal rack or tray to prevent the cookware from coming into contact with the oven walls. Additionally, users should avoid using metal utensils, such as forks or knives, to stir or remove food from the oven, as they can cause sparks or arcing. By following the manufacturer’s guidelines and taking necessary precautions, users can safely and effectively use their convection microwave oven with metal cookware.
